About Our Partner: For many low-income communities, affordable food, especially affordable healthy food, is in short supply. To help address this problem, Heartland Human Care Services (HHCS), in partnership with the City of Chicago, NeighborSpace, Rush University Medical Center, Breakthrough Ministries, and Our Lady of the Angels Food Pantry, operates two urban farm lots in Chicago’s East Garfield Park neighborhood called Chicago FarmWorks. They are able to grow, harvest and distribute produce with crucial support from volunteers and transitional job participants who are working to overcome many barriers to secure permanent full-time jobs. The produce they grow on their two farm lots goes to food pantry partners, Breakthrough Ministries Fresh Market and Mission of Our Lady of the Angels food pantry, where it is distributed directly to hundreds of individuals and families each week.
